* [PATCH v2] cpufreq: intel_pstate: Improve IO performance

In the current implementation the latency from SCHED_CPUFREQ_IOWAIT is
set to actual P-state adjustment can be upto 10ms. This can be improved
by reacting to SCHED_CPUFREQ_IOWAIT by jumping to max P-state immediately
. With this change the IO performance improves significantly.

With a simple "grep -r . linux" (Here linux is kernel source folder) with
dropped caches every time on a platform with per core P-states on a
Broadwell Xeon workstation, the user and system time improves as much as
30% to 40%.

The same performance difference was not observed on clients, which don't
have per core P-state support.

v2:
As suggested by Rafael also updating  cpu->last_update time

 drivers/cpufreq/intel_pstate.c | 10 ++++++++++
 1 file changed, 10 insertions(+)

diff --git a/drivers/cpufreq/intel_pstate.c b/drivers/cpufreq/intel_pstate.c
index 90e8f2b..1cb318b 100644
--- a/drivers/cpufreq/intel_pstate.c
+++ b/drivers/cpufreq/intel_pstate.c
@@ -1530,6 +1530,15 @@ static void intel_pstate_update_util(struct update_util_data *data, u64 time,
 
 	if (flags & SCHED_CPUFREQ_IOWAIT) {
 		cpu->iowait_boost = int_tofp(1);
+		cpu->last_update = time;
+		/*
+		 * The last time the busy was 100% so P-state was max anyway
+		 * so avoid overhead of computation.
+		 */
+		if (fp_toint(cpu->sample.busy_scaled) == 100)
+			return;
+
+		goto set_pstate;
 	} else if (cpu->iowait_boost) {
 		/* Clear iowait_boost if the CPU may have been idle. */
 		delta_ns = time - cpu->last_update;
@@ -1541,6 +1550,7 @@ static void intel_pstate_update_util(struct update_util_data *data, u64 time,
 	if ((s64)delta_ns < INTEL_PSTATE_DEFAULT_SAMPLING_INTERVAL)
 		return;
 
+set_pstate:
 	if (intel_pstate_sample(cpu, time)) {
 		int target_pstate;
